body
{
       background:#6895cc url(/img/bg-thrill.jpg) no-repeat; 
}

#top { background:none;}
#bottom { background:none;}


h1{
	background-image:url(/img/bg-whatson.jpg);
	background-color: #857C32;
}

h2 a,h2 a:visited{
	color:#FFFFFF;

}
h2 a:hover{

	color:#FFFFFF;
}
h3{
	color:#FF7900;
}
#sub_header{
	background-color:#958B38;
}
#content-left-navigation-box{

	background-image:url(/img/i_middle_content-left_fill_whatson.gif);

}
.content-left-box-header{
	background-color:#766B2D;
}
#content-left-video-box{
	background-color:#958B38;
}
#content-left-itinerary{
	background-color:#958B38;
}
#content-left-request-brochure{
	background-color:#958B38;
}
#content-right_header{

	/* background-image:url(/img/headers/i_main_image_whats_on.jpg); */
}
#content-right-main{

	background-image:url(/img/content_text_box.gif);
}

div#thedms65.BrowseCellh2,div#thedms65.BrowseCellh2 a,div#thedms65.BrowseCellh2 a:visited{
	color:#FFFFFF;
}
div#thedms65.BrowseCellh2 a:hover{
	color:#FFFFFF;
}
#content-right-main-dms{
}

.content-lower-nav-box-2 a, .content-lower-nav-box-2 a:visited, .content-lower-navigation-box a, .content-lower-navigation-box a:visited {
	background-image:url(../img/bg-whatson.jpg);
	background-color: #857C32;
}

.left-box a, .left-box a:visited {
	color:#6C6628;
}
.content-holder-extra-quicklinks li {
	background-repeat: repeat-x;
	background-image:url(/img/bg-whatson.jpg);
	background-color: #857C32;
}

/* -- new styles for 2010 website -- */


.quicklinks li {
    background-color:#A8A061; /*darker colour */
    background-image:url("/img/bg-whatson.jpg");
}
#footer-bar {
    background-color:#A8A061; /*darker colour */
    background-image:url("/img/bg-whatson.jpg");
}


#content-holder-centre-wrap .double-left, #content-holder-centre-wrap .double-right, #content-holder-centre-wrap .triple-left, #content-holder-centre-wrap .triple-right  {
    background-color:#A8A061; /*darker colour */
}

#navigation-sub {
    background-color: #FF7900; /* middle of gradient colour */
}

#navigation-sub li a, #navigation-sub li a:visited {
	background-color:#FF7900;; /* middle of gradient colour */
	border-right:1px solid #E9E4BF; /* lighter colour */
	color:#fff; /* lighter links */
}

.content-lower-nav-box-2 h5, .content-lower-navigation-box h5 {
    background-color:#A8A061; /* darker colour */
    background-image:url("/img/bg-whatson.jpg");
}

.double .buttons {
    background-color: #A8A061; /* darker colour */
    padding: 3px;
}
.triple .buttons {
    background-color: #A8A061; /* darker colour */
    padding: 3px;
}


div.thedmsBrowsePagination a.thedmsPaginationCurrentPage, div.thedmsBrowsePagination a:hover  {
    background:none repeat scroll 0 0 #A8A061; /* darker colour */
}

.button a, .button a:visited {
    background-color:#FF7A01;background-image:none;border:none;
}
div#thedms02n h2, div#thedmsAccessibility h3 {
    background-image:url("/img/bg-whatson.jpg");
}
div#thedms02n .thedmsGridTableHeader, #thedmsGridAvailabilityChart .thedmsGridTableHeader th, #TB_ajaxContent h2 {
    background-image:url("/img/bg-whatson.jpg");
    border-right: 1px solid #A8A061; /* darker colour */
}
.thedmsGridTableBorder  {
    border-left:1px solid #A8A061; /* darker colour */
    border-top:1px solid #A8A061; /* darker colour */
    border-bottom:1px solid #A8A061; /* darker colour */
}
#thedmsAvailability td {
    border-right: 1px solid #A8A061; /* darker colour */
    border-top:1px solid #A8A061;  /* darker colour */
}

#thedmsDetailsPanel h2, #thedmsOpeningDetails h2, #thedmsItemsPanel h2, #thedmsContactPanel h2, #thedmsOpeningDetails h2, #thedmsItemsPanel h2 {
    background:#FF7A01;
}

/******DMS table styles by NS**************/

/*dms key on venue pages*/
.thedmskey 
{
    border:1px solid #FF7A01;
}

div#thedms13 div#thedmsItemsPanel p
{
    border-color: #FF7A01;
}

div#thedmsItemsPanel 
{
    background-color:#FAF9EF;  
}

table#thedmsBrowseEvents
{
    background-color: #A8A061;
}

div#thedmsBrowseGrid .BrowseRow 
{
    border:1px solid #FF7A01;
}

/****** END of DMS table styles by NS**************/


/*HCL Changes*/
/*TC styles added 20.05.2010*/
#content-right-main-dms h1 {
	background:transparent url(/img/bg-h1-thrill.jpg) no-repeat scroll 0 0; 
	color:#fff;
	padding-left:6px;
}
#content-right-main-dms h1 p {
	color:#fff
}

#content-right-main-dms .half .box h2, #content-right-main-dms .half .box h2 a {
background-color:#FF7900;
color:#fff;
background-image:none;
}
li.thrill-hopper a {
background-color:#FF7900 !important;
}
#content-holder-centre-wrap {
	width: 612px;}
	

/*background colour for h2 of quarter box row*/
#content-right-footer .box h2, #content-right-footer .box h2 a
{
    background-color:#FF7900;
}

#content-right-main-dms .third .box h2, #content-right-main-dms .third .box h2 a
{
    background-color:#FF7900;
}

#content-right-main-dms .third .box h2, #content-right-main-dms .third .box h2 a 
{
    color:#fff;
}

#content-right-footer .box h2, #content-right-footer .box h2 a
{
    color:#fff;
}

div#thedmsBrowseGrid .BrowseCell h2 {
    background:#FF7A01;
}
.more-info a, .more-info a:visited, .viewmore a, viewmore a:visited {
	background: none #ff7700;
	color:#fff;
}

/********************************global basket button styles*******************************/
.button a, .button a:visited, #content-right-footer .button a, #content-right-footer .button a:visited,
.global-basket-iframe div.button a  
{
    background-color:#FF7900;
}

/********************************END global basket button styles***************************/	

table#thedmsOpeningTimesTableFullWidth th  {background-color: #FF7A01;}

table#thedmsBrowseEvents {background-color: #FF7A01;}

table#thedmsBrowseEvents th {background-color: #FF7A01;}
